A Japanese carved ivory okimono figure group
Modelled as four figures, probably four of the Seven Gods of Good Fortune, around a tree, comprising a female (Benzaiten) with palm leaf, a male (Fukurokuju) with prominent forehead, and two smaller figures holding fans, probably Daikoku and Ebisu, two-character mark to base, 3.5", (9cm) high
